The Sound Blaster Z SE is alive and well on Windows 11. While official labeling might be sparse, the Windows 10 64-bit drivers provided on the Creative support page are stable and fully compatible. For the best experience, avoid relying on Windows Update drivers and always install the official package directly from the link above.
